Heads up: the Gatewright API gateway just started throttling your plugin's calls. This alert fires when a plugin exceeds its burst allowance twice within five minutes — usually it means a retry loop gone feral or a missing backoff. Requests over the limit get a 429 with a retry-after hint, so please honor it. Quotas differ per tier, and you can request a bump if you genuinely need more headroom. The current limits, tiers, and the bump-request process are all documented here:

wiki page, yahop-tajef: https://jira.zemvarsys.internal/browse/display/display/pages

## Deploying the Gatewick Proctor Queue

Deploys are pretty painless: push to main, wait for the pipeline, then watch the queue drain dashboard for five minutes. If candidates pile up mid-exam, roll back first and ask questions later — the queue replays safely. Everything the workers care about lives in one config block, shown here for reference.

settings of bafof-yagef:
JOROX_PIN=8740
JOROX_TENANT=pelox
JOROX_METRICS_HOST=metrics.jorox.qorvelworks.internal
JOROX_SEAL=seal_c78f63c1
JOROX_STANDBY_TEAM=norax

## Further Reading

Spoolhawk is the printer-spooler microservice behind Quillbridge's document pipeline. It accepts render jobs, queues them per site, and retries on device faults. You'll mostly touch the retry logic and the dead-letter drain. Don't modify queue ordering without reading the fairness notes first — the Marlowe office outage taught us that lesson. Config lives in the service repo; secrets are injected at deploy. Architecture diagrams, queue semantics, and the on-call escalation path are all collected on one internal page.

operations page: https://confluence.tolvaqsys.corp/spaces/pages/pages/6e787158f507

## Watchdog Environment Variables

For review: Perchlight kiosks run a watchdog (`perch-watch`) that restarts the UI if it hangs. Relevant vars: `WATCH_INTERVAL_SECS` (default 15), `WATCH_MAX_RESTARTS` (default 5), and `WATCH_REPORT_URL` for heartbeat posts. Heartbeats are signed, so the env file must also carry the signing secret — it goes on this line:

secret setting of yajog-taguf: ARCHIVE_KEY3=051